    James Albert Varney Jr. (June 15, 1949 – February 10, 2000) was an American actor and comedian. He is best known for his comedic role as Ernest P. Worrell , for which he won a Daytime Emmy Award , as well as appearing in films and numerous television commercial advertising campaigns.
